Default What was it , then ?

Was it the couplings ? Play in the shafts appears to be the indicator I think ?
Reason for asking is that I have a 'metallic' rasping if you like and visually the SADS seem ok. Have posted here before( well when it the old site !! ) but never get a satisfactory reply from anyone. Oh yeah, only noticeable below 2000 RPM ( ?! ). Still happening. After lots of searching on the 'net, another culprit may be the vacuum pump, or the EGR valve. Haven't had time/inclination to get to any of these parts yet. Another suggestion was the turbo ( bloody hope not though !! ).
You might want to be sure of other options for mysterious noises, before shelling out for SADS changes.
